Patent number: 11863470Abstract: An apparatus includes a network interface and a processing unit. The network interface transmits a security payload. The processing unit determines a first partition of a queuing service for the security payload at a first time, at least in part based on a determination that an initial attempt to transmit the security payload failed. The processing unit also instructs a retrieval of the security payload from the first partition to perform a first retry attempt to transmit the security payload, at least in part based on a determination that a first retry interval since the first time has elapsed.Type: GrantFiled: November 10, 2021Date of Patent: January 2, 2024Assignee: Musarubra US LLCInventors: Senthil K. Venkatesan, Arthur S. Zeigler, Sudeep Das, Anders Swanson

Patent number: 11047703Abstract: A method for depicting location attributes in a map environment. The method includes receiving a request for parameters about a first type of location. The method includes determining a first set of directional arrows, where each directional arrow is associated with a location and has a first set of properties based on the parameters about the first type of location. The method further includes determining a selection of a first directional arrow, which is associated with a first location, from the first set of directional arrows. Modifications to the first set of directional arrows are made based on the selection of the first directional arrow.Type: GrantFiled: January 24, 2019Date of Patent: June 29, 2021Assignee: Airbnb, Inc.Inventors: Francis Sujai Arokiaraj, Senthil K. Venkatesan

Patent number: 10123090Abstract: Systems, methods, and computer program products to perform an operation comprising receiving a video comprising audio data and image data, processing the audio data to identify a first concept in a speech captured in the audio data at a first point in time of the video, identifying a first supplemental image based on the first concept, wherein the first supplemental image visually conveys the concept, and responsive to receiving an indication to play the video, outputting the first supplemental image proximate to the first point in time of the video.Type: GrantFiled: August 24, 2016Date of Patent: November 6, 2018Assignee: International Business Machines CorporationInventors: Francis S. Arokiaraj, Senthil K. Venkatesan

Patent number: 9925916Abstract: Embodiments of the present invention provide methods, systems, and computer program products for generating a linear projection of a route. In one embodiment, route information is received and parsed. Supplementary route data is received. A linear route is generated and provided to a user, the linear route comprising a straight line and one or more segments extending form the straight line, where ends of the straight line represent a starting point and destination of the linear route, and the one or more segments represent turns.Type: GrantFiled: January 16, 2017Date of Patent: March 27, 2018Assignee: International Business Machines CorporationInventors: Rajesh Kalyanaraman, Senthil K. Venkatesan

Patent number: 9903735Abstract: An approach for a route stabilization scrolling mode is provided. The approach displays a map window, wherein the map window includes a visible region of a map, the map including a plotted route originating at a source location and ending at a destination location. The approach receives one or more swipe gestures within the map window. The approach determines whether the one or more swipe gestures exceeds an escape velocity threshold. Responsive to a determination that the one or more swipe gestures exceeds the level of intensity to progress the map window into an area of the map away from the plotted route, the approach generates one or more custom pegs, wherein the one or more custom pegs is a compressed snapshot of a last position on the plotted route prior to exceeding the escape velocity threshold.Type: GrantFiled: March 30, 2015Date of Patent: February 27, 2018Assignee: International Business Machines CorporationInventors: Rajesh Kalyanaraman, Senthil K. Venkatesan

Patent number: 9747256Abstract: Presenting text and figures on a display screen by formatting, by a computer, text in a document into a single display line, scrolling the single display line on a first portion of the display screen, wherein the display screen remains active, and displaying, on a second portion of the display screen, figures in the document referenced by the scrolled text in the single display line on the display screen.Type: GrantFiled: February 26, 2015Date of Patent: August 29, 2017Assignee: International Business Machines CorporationInventors: Rajesh Kalyanaraman, Senthil K. Venkatesan

Patent number: 9547411Abstract: Embodiments include a system, method and computer program product for navigating a graphical representation displayed in a graphical user interface (GUI). According to one embodiment, the method includes receiving, at a computer system, a first input indicating a selection of a source element, receiving a second input indicating a relationship for the source element, identifying one or more target elements having a relationship with the source element, and displaying the one or more target elements identified within a visible area of a display.Type: GrantFiled: March 9, 2015Date of Patent: January 17, 2017Assignee: INTERNATIONAL BUSINESS MACHINES CORPORATIONInventors: Francis S. Arokiaraj, Sairam Bantupalli, Sreenivasulu Valmeti, Senthil K. Venkatesan
